What is homeostasis & provide an example
It maintains the internal balance in the body in response to environmental changes
Ex. Sweat in hot summer to cool off
What does energy have to do with cells
They obtain energy and use it
What does ATP stand for
Adenosine triphosphate
What does ATP do?
Powers daily function and repair/replaced damaged cells
